Ethereum’s Challenge: Power Without Efficiency

Ethereum’s growth has been both its triumph and its constraint. The network now processes millions of transactions per day, yet its validator model has grown increasingly complex. Gas fees fluctuate wildly, and staking yields often serve those with the largest wallets rather than those providing meaningful compute.

Vitalik has repeatedly pointed out that scaling through brute force, layering rollups and liquidity bridges, cannot sustain decentralised integrity forever. His vision of Ethereum vs zk technology acknowledges that privacy, compression, and verifiability are not optional upgrades; they are the next stage of blockchain functionality. Vitalik Buterin’s ZK Vision: Computation as Proof

When Vitalik champions zero-knowledge proofs, he’s calling for a blockchain that proves its correctness without exposing internal data. In simple terms, Vitalik Buterin’s zk cryptography is about trust through math, not assumption. It’s a way to make computation verifiable, private, and scalable, all at once.
